What will this day be about?

1. Introducing PRIMMA – Accelerating Private Networks in Main Ports

We are happy to announce the official name for this initiative: PRIMMA – PRivate networks Initiative for Main ports Market Acceleration. This name reflects our shared ambition to drive innovation and unlock the full potential of private networks for main ports.

2. Knowledge Mission on Private Networks @ MWC Barcelona

Before our Rotterdam session, we have another exciting milestone: MWC Barcelona (March 3-6, 2025). Private networks will take center stage as part of the Netherlands program, and we are organizing a dedicated knowledge mission—similar to our successful initiative in 2024. Expect deeper insights and high-impact discussions! The kick-off event for the Netherlands program will take place on February 6th.

Our agenda will focus on:
- Review of round 1 of the round table in both air and sea ports
- Use cases for private networks in both air and seaports
- A structured approach towards standardized solutions
- An overview of EU regulations and private spectrum opportunities
- Knowledge sharing and best practices
- Tangible deliverables on programme elements such as landlord roles, ecosystem templates, etc.
